Background: Salmonella enterica subsp. enterica serovar Poona (antigenic formula 1,13,22:z:1,6:[z44],[z59]) is a serovar of the O:13 (G) serogroup.
Animal reservoir: Serovar Poona is found in turtles, and has been associated with salmonellosis outbreaks in pet turtles.

Outbreaks:
Year | Location | Associated Source | Number of Cases |
---|---|---|---|
2015-2016 | US-multistate | Pet turtles | 70 |
2015-2016 | US-multistate | Cucumbers from Mexico | 907 |
2015 | US-multistate | Pet turtles | 25 |
